Grilled Chicken with Avocado Salsa

Grilled Chicken with Avocado Salsa consists of boneless skinless chicken breasts marinated in garlic, olive oil, cilantro, lime juice, and spices then grilled to a charred finish. Fresh avocado salsa made from diced avocado, tomato, onion, jalapeño, cilantro, and lime juice complements the smoky chicken. The dish offers a balance of savory grill flavor and bright, creamy salsa, ideal for a light and flavorful meal.

Description

This recipe starts by making a marinade with minced garlic, olive oil, chopped cilantro, lime juice,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. The chicken breasts, pounded or halved for even thickness, are coated with the marinade and allowed to rest from 30 minutes up to 12 hours for flavor development. Grilling over medium-high heat for about 5 to 6 minutes per side cooks the chicken through while imparting a slight char on the exterior.

The accompanying avocado salsa combines diced avocado, chopped tomato, red onion, diced jalapeño (optional for heat), cilantro, lime juice, salt, and black pepper. This fresh salsa provides a creamy, tangy contrast to the smoky, seasoned chicken.

Served immediately after grilling, this dish pairs well with simple sides such as rice, salad, or grilled vegetables. The marinade and salsa components highlight fresh herbs and citrus, offering a balanced combination with the hearty grilled chicken.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 1 1/2 pounds chicken breast or 4 chicken breasts, boneless skinless

For the Marinade

  • 2 garlic cloves, finely minced
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• ¼ cup cilantro chopped
  • lime juice of 1
  • 1/2 tsp. cumin
  • ½ tsp paprika
  • ½ tsp salt or to taste
  • ¼ tsp black pepper

Avocado Salsa

  • 2 avocado diced
  • 2 tomato chopped, small or 1 large
  • ¼ cup red onion chopped
  • 1 jalapeño de-seeded and chopped (optional)
  • 1/4 cup cilantro finely chopped
  • lime juice of 1
  • black pepper fresh cracked pepper, to taste
  • salt fresh cracked p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, whisk all the ingredients for the marinade and set aside. 
  2. Pound the breasts to even thickness or slice in half horizontally to get evenly sized breasts and add to the bowl of marinade. Mix through until the chicken is fully coated in the marinade. Use right away if needed or marinate for 30-minutes or up to 12 hours.
  3. Grill chicken over medium-high heat or in a large heavy-duty skillet on the stovetop for 5-6 minutes per side or until the inside is cooked through and the outside is charred. Top with fresh avocado salsa and serve immediately.

To Make Avocado Salsa

  1. While the chicken is grilled, combine all the ingredients for the salsa in a small bowl. Cover with plastic wrap in the fridge until ready to use.
